Why These Are the Top Chevrolet Repair Auto Repair Shops in Audubon

** The Chevrolet repair market serving Audubon, MN, is concentrated in the nearby hub of Detroit Lakes. The market is characterized by a few long-standing, family-owned businesses that have built their reputation on serving the agricultural and lakes community, where Chevrolet trucks and SUVs are dominant. The competition level is moderate but quality is generally high, as these businesses rely heavily on word-of-mouth and long-term customer relationships. You will not find a high-volume, quick-lube style chain that specializes in the services you require; instead, the top providers are smaller shops with seasoned technicians. Pricing is typical for a rural Minnesota market—competitive and often more affordable than dealerships in larger cities, without sacrificing expertise for the most common Chevrolet models and repairs. For highly specialized performance work (e.g., advanced Corvette tuning), owners may need to travel to a larger metropolitan area like Fargo, ND, or the Twin Cities.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about chevrolet repair services in Audubon, MN

What are the most common Chevrolet repair issues for vehicles driven in the Audubon, MN area?

Due to our cold winters and road salt, common issues include rust-related brake line and fuel line corrosion, as well as premature wear on suspension components like control arms and ball joints. Chevrolet trucks and SUVs also frequently need 4WD system servicing and battery replacements due to extreme temperature swings.

How can I find a trustworthy, specialized Chevrolet repair shop near Audubon?

Look for a shop with GM/Chevrolet-specific training (like ASE or GM World Class Technician certifications) and one that uses genuine GM parts or high-quality OEM equivalents. In the Audubon and Detroit Lakes area, checking for long-standing local reputation and reviews from other Chevrolet owners is key.

When should I seek immediate service for my Chevrolet in our local climate?

Seek immediate service if you notice signs of brake failure, especially after winter, or if your Chevrolet's engine is overheating, which can be exacerbated during summer. Also, don't ignore 4WD warning lights before our snowy season, as you'll need that system reliable.

Are repair costs for Chevrolets generally higher at dealerships versus independent shops in this region?

Typically, dealerships in nearby Detroit Lakes may have slightly higher labor rates, but they offer manufacturer-specific expertise and original GM parts. Independent shops in Audubon can offer competitive pricing and personalized service, especially for older models, so it's wise to get quotes for comparison.

What local considerations should I keep in mind for Chevrolet maintenance in Audubon?

Adhere strictly to severe service maintenance schedules for oil changes and fluid flushes due to our temperature extremes and dusty rural roads. Prioritize undercarriage washes in winter to combat salt corrosion and ensure your cooling system and battery are tested before winter and summer seasons.
